Upcoming Events

Ballet Dance classes

Exciting Upcoming Events

We strive to make dance as convenient as possible for you and your children. Check out our schedule of upcoming events, performances, and rehearsal dates so you can make any necessary arrangements.

In order to keep our studio fun and exciting, our friendly staff is always coming up with new activities and events to host. From learning sessions, workshops, and camps to performance recitals, we strive to make everyone feel like more than just a student or parent. Schedule a one day workshop for your group – we want you to feel like a part of our community!

Take a look through some of our upcoming events and please do not hesitate to give us a call if you have any questions. Additionally, if you are interested in hosting an event or have a great idea to help get people involved, we would love to hear about it!

Check Back Often for the Latest News

  • Schedule updates
  • Performance dates
  • Rehearsal dates
  • Special events and gatherings
  • Meet and greets
  • Celebrations and more
Ballet Dance classes


VISIT OUR STUDIO - 300 Chatham Heights Road
                                     Suite 105
                                    Fredericksburg, Va. 22405
                                    Wednesday, August 23, 2017
                                     4:30pm -7:00pm
  • CALL (540)-371-8992
  • EMAIL - jamkegg@gmail.com

Ballet Dance classes

Fall Class Schedule September 11, 2017- June 2018


4:30 PM - 5:30 PM   Ballet Int. 1 and 2
5:30 PM - 6:15 PM  Beg. Point
6:15 PM - 7:15 PM  Ballet Adv.
7:15 PM - 8:00 PM  Adv. Point


4:15 PM - 5:15 PM Pre-Ballet (ages 5 and 6)
5:15 PM - 6:00 PM Creative Dance (ages 3-5)
6:00 PM - 7:00 PM Beg. Ballet 2
7:00 PM - 8:00 PM Adult Ballet


6:00 PM - 7:15 PM Jazz (age 7 and up)
7:30 PM - 8:30 PM Adult Dance


3:30 PM - 4:15 PM Creative Dance (ages 3-5)
4:15 PM - 5:15 PM Beg. Ballet 1 (ages 7 and up)
5:15 PM - 6:15 PM Beg. Ballet 3
6:15 PM - 7:30 PM Ballet  Adv.
 5:00PM -6:15PM Ballet Adv.
 6:15PM - 7;30PM Int. Ballet 1 & 2
 9:30AM - 10:30AM Pre-Ballet (ages 5-6)
 10:30AM- 11:30AM Beg. Ballet 1

Morning Classes

9:30 AM -10:30 AM Adult Ballet
10:30AM - 11:30AM Beg. Ballet (ages 8 & up)
11:45AM -12:45AM Pre- Ballet (ages 5 -&)
10:15 AM -11:15 AM Adult Ballet

Watch for our Spring Break &Summer Camps

Learn More About Our Summer Camps

Is your child ready to delve into the world of dance? Our special summer camps are a great option to get a fun, intensive introduction to the world of dance while making great new friends and having a lot of fun! Give us a call today to learn more about our upcoming summer camp programs.
              Watch for dates for Spring Break Camp & Summer Camps

Spring Break Camp  dates to be announced soon

Call our friendly, helpful staff for any further questions you have regarding our schedules and events.
At Stafford Ballet Academy,
children and adults of all ages
are welcome.
Share by: